Monday, November 28, 2011

Q 777: The Pendulum Swings To & Fro


This particular term that I'm looking for comes from "___". The term's origin/root essentially means "Regarding the Head" in Latin.
__X__ has been practiced by most civilizations at some point of time or the other, with the exception of the Kyivian Rus(European tribe that was disintegrated by the Mongol Invasion in the 13th Century).

The current scenario, however, is different.
58 Nations are advocates of __X__ and 96 have decided to do away with the concept altogether.
There is of course this raging debate on __X__ on many fronts.

The European Union has collectively distanced itself away from it, as Article 2 of the Charter of Fundamental Rights of the EU prohibits it.

In the UNGA, The People's Republic of China, India, the USA and Indonesia have all voted against the removal of __X___, and they being the 4t most populated countries in the world.


Rohan Danait said...

Capital punishment
Had appeared in one of the Landmark quizzes

Quizzard of Oz said...

Capital Punishment

abhimanyu said...

capital punishment

Anonymous said...

X is capital punishment. I'm guessing the latin word you're looking for is capital! Cheers.

Anonymous said...

capital punishment

raghav said...

coming from "de capite"